Sale 1162, Lot 160, Postage Currency and Encased PostageBrown's Bronchial Troches, Boston Mass., 10c Green (EP34). Stamp with rich color and detailed impression and attractively placed so denomination is clearly visible, large part of original silvering on reverse, mica with one or two small spots of laminating, Extremely Fine, an outstanding example of this issue and rare in this pristine condition, John I. Brown & Son was a Boston-based patent medicine manufacturer and marketer, Brown's Bronchial Troches was advertised as a tonic for the throat and breathing passages with endorsements from singers, teachers, ministers and others, the firm was later associated with the sale of the notorious "Mrs. Winslow's Soothing Syrup," a morphine and alcohol-based concoction that caused the deaths of hundreds of children through overdoses, ex Lilly, Ford and Litle
